Ordinals
beta
Sat 1765410189264239
decimal
572328.189264239
degree
0°152328′1800″189264239‴
percentile
84.06715196219957%
name
bipfbcnmqxe
cycle
0
epoch
2
period
283
block
572328
offset
189264239
timestamp
2019-04-19 14:48:19 UTC
rarity
common
prev
next